### Runbook: Tenant Rate Quotas — Gatemill

Gatemill enforces per-tenant request quotas at the edge. When a tenant reports throttling, first confirm whether they exceeded their tier limit or hit the global ceiling; the metrics dashboard distinguishes the two. Quota overrides expire automatically after 24 hours, so do not file a change request for temporary bumps. The effective quota configuration for production is as follows.

config for yawep-tajef:
[kelion]
team = kelys
access_code = ac_1a130d
owner = holax.aldmir
host = kelion.urlaqforge.example
port = 9090
peer = fenmir.lumicio.example
salt = d0dd3cb5
pin = 3295

Team,

The cut-over of Hueproof, our color-contrast audit service, completed last night. All scan jobs now run on the Larkfield cluster; the old queue is drained and retired. Expect slightly faster report generation and a new severity field in results. If customers report stale scores, ask them to re-run the audit. The service now runs with the configuration values below.

deployment values, kahof-yadug:
[gorys]
team = silael
access_code = ac_00d620
owner = istox.oliys
host = gorys.torvastack.example
port = 9000
peer = holmir.merlaqsoft.example
salt = 9fdae78a
pin = 2358

## Deep-Link Routing Basics

When Lanternly receives a universal link, the RouteBridge module validates the path against a signed manifest before dispatching to a screen. If validation fails, users land on the fallback home view — this is intentional, not a crash. On-call should first check manifest freshness, then the router logs, before assuming a client defect. If both look healthy but misroutes persist, escalate with sample links to the routing team at the address below.

alerts address for faduf-yajeg: drumir@nelvroworks.internal

## Archiving cold storage buckets

Support handles archive requests for Frostbin buckets older than 180 days. Verify the customer's retention tier first, then set `ARCHIVE_REGION` and `ARCHIVE_TTL_DAYS` in the worker env. Dry-run mode is on by default; keep it on until the request is confirmed. The archiver signs each manifest using the key placed on the next line.

secret setting of yafof-tawep: RELAY_SECRET8=8abb5772